Cottonbelt Trail is a 5.2-mile out-and-back near Smithfield, TX. It is mostly level, with 28 ft of elevation gain, and mostly paved.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

  1. Start at the trailhead, heading SW.
  2. 200 ftTurn right onto Walker's Creek Trail, heading W.
  3. 50 ftTurn left onto Cottonbelt Trail, heading SW.
  4. 2.7 miReach the turnaround, then head back the way you came.
  5. 0.5 miTurn left, heading NE.
  6. 2.1 miTurn right onto Walker's Creek Trail, heading NE.
  7. 50 ftTurn left, heading NE.
  8. 50 ftArrive back at the trailhead.

Each distance is the walk from the previous step. Tap a step for a map of its junction.
